Design and performance of a miniature TDCR counting system

Résumé

A portable liquid scintillation counting system based on the triple-to-double coincidence ratio (TDCR) method was developed at Sofia University "St. Kliment Ohridski". The system consists of a miniature TDCR counter with cylindrical optical chamber and a specialized TDCR counting module named nanoTDCR. The nanoTDCR module is produced by the labZY company and provides several important new TDCR counting functionalities like: individual extending-type dead-time in each channel; simultaneous counting with two different extendable dead-times and two different coincidence windows and simultaneous TDCR counting and spectrum acquisition. The performance of the new system was tested in benchmark comparisons with the LNHB's primary TDCR counting system of activity measurements of Am-241, H-3, C-14 and Ni-63. Good agreement between the two systems was observed.
